为什么我的棋盘显示不出来?

来源:2-2 画棋盘

qq_一亩地_0

2016-03-28 11:45


var chess=document.getElementById('chess');

var context=chess.getContext('2d');


context.strokeStyle="#bfbfbf";


for(var i=0;i<15;i++){

context.moveTo(15+i*30,15);

    context.lineTo(15+i*30,435);

    context.stroke();

context.moveTo(15,15+i*30);

    context.lineTo(435,15+i*30);

    context.stroke();

}


写回答 关注

4回答

  • Eyeland
    2016-04-03 13:52:27
    已采纳

    你要让文档加载后才加载js  如果放在头部就在window。onload=function(){代码都放这里}

    要么把js放在canvas后  让canvas创建了才画图

    qq_一亩地...

    非常感谢!

    2016-04-08 09:36:50

    共 1 条回复 >

  • 星空中最美的夜
    2016-04-06 16:15:09

    我也不出来, 是因为我把JS写在<head></head>标签里

  • qq_web_3
    2016-03-29 11:58:36

    我的也是,请问你解决了没有

  • 慕码人4671379
    2016-03-28 15:16:44

    你看一下js文件是不是正确引用了

JS实现人机大战之五子棋(UI篇)

利用js及canvas绘图知识,实现程序界面编写和交互逻辑处理

35650 学习 · 136 问题

查看课程

相似问题